I suppose \u2018stupid\u2019 is perhaps a bit strong, but the alternative \u2013 that they are just <strong>average<\/strong> people \u2013 is potentially even more worrying, since it means that there\u2019s a lot more of them around.<\/p>\n<p>Sticking with the bleach thing for a moment, household products are not manufactured under conditions that make them anywhere near suitable for internal use. They are even further away from being suitable for <strong>intravenous<\/strong> use. An example would be calcium supplement tablets. The raw material in those is often calcium carbonate \u2013 but the quality of that material is nothing like the calcium carbonate that would be used in cement, which is another of its applications. The stuff in the tablets is purified in a lab to make it suitable for ingestion. The stuff used in cement pretty much comes straight out of a limestone quarry.<\/p>\n<p>Household cleaners share a similar gulf in how \u2018clean\u2019 they are, with the additional problem being that you don\u2019t use bleach \u2013 particularly chlorine-based bleaches &#8211; internally for anything. They are corrosive <strong>and<\/strong> toxic. Even gentler bleaches like the peroxides are used highly diluted and for external purposes (tooth whitening, for example).<\/p>\n<p>But the problem seems to be that stupidity \u2013 or averageness \u2013 isn\u2019t confined to Trump, the Americans, or any other nation, although there does seem to be a link between education and being prepared to do things that it might have been best not to.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Let\u2019s summarise the problem we have.
